All errors (new ones prefixed by >>):

   drivers/soc/qcom/cpr.c: In function 'cpr_populate_ring_osc_idx':
>> drivers/soc/qcom/cpr.c:814:23: error: implicit declaration of function 'nvmem_cell_read_variable_le_u32' [-Werror=implicit-function-declaration]
     814 |                 ret = nvmem_cell_read_variable_le_u32(drv->dev, fuses->ring_osc, &data);
         |                       ^~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
   cc1: some warnings being treated as errors


vim +/nvmem_cell_read_variable_le_u32 +814 drivers/soc/qcom/cpr.c

   803	
   804	static int
   805	cpr_populate_ring_osc_idx(struct cpr_drv *drv)
   806	{
   807		struct fuse_corner *fuse = drv->fuse_corners;
   808		struct fuse_corner *end = fuse + drv->desc->num_fuse_corners;
   809		const struct cpr_fuse *fuses = drv->cpr_fuses;
   810		u32 data;
   811		int ret;
   812	
   813		for (; fuse < end; fuse++, fuses++) {
 > 814			ret = nvmem_cell_read_variable_le_u32(drv->dev, fuses->ring_osc, &data);
   815			if (ret)
   816				return ret;
   817			fuse->ring_osc_idx = data;
   818		}
   819	
   820		return 0;
   821	}
   822
